如何编程访问(读,写)Revit项目信息
转载请复制以下信息:
原文链接: http://blog.csdn.net/joexiongjin/article/details/8000994
作者: 叶雄进 , Autodesk ADN
我们经常需要访问Revit的模型信息,本文介绍些如何获取项目信息以及读写项目名称或项目编号等信息。
Revit的项目由ProjectInfo这个类来表示,在一个文件中,只有一个这个类的实例,可以从Document.ProjectInformation 属性获得这个唯一的对象。
Revit的项目名称,项目编号,项目状态,项目地址等都以参数的形式存数在ProjectInfo对象中,所以可以通过读写参数的API实现对项目名称,项目编号,项目状态,项目地址等的读取。
比如修改项目的地址:
ProjectInfo proj = doc.ProjectInformation;
Parameter param = proj.get_Parameter(BuiltInParameter.PROJECT_ADDRESS) //获取项目地址,通过项目地址对应的内置枚举成员
param.Set("北京朝阳区。。。");
最后提交所作修改的事务。
如何编程访问(读,写)Revit项目信息相关推荐
- 【十万个编程篇】写文章与“写项目”的差别
自古暨今,世间陆续诞生出"现象级"的文学作品,如<左传>.<桃花源记>.<背影>等文章,又如<咏鹅>.<将进酒>.< ...
- asp.net医院信息管理系统VS开发sqlserver数据库web结构c#编程计算机网页源码项目
一.源码特点 asp.net 医院信息管理系统是一套完善的web设计管理系统,系统具有完整的源代码和数据库,系统主要采用B/S模式开发,开发环境为vs2010,数据库为sqlserve ...
- android编程权威指南 的PhotoGallery项目Flickr 不能访问的替代解决方法
android编程权威指南 的PhotoGallery项目Flickr 不能访问的替代解决方法 参考: <<android编程权威指南(第2版)>>的PhotoGallery项 ...
- asp.netNBA信息管理系统VS开发sqlserver数据库web结构c#编程计算机网页源码项目详细设计
一.源码特点 asp.net NBA信息管理系统 是一套完善的web设计管理系统,系统具有完整的源代码和数据库,开发环境为vs2010,数据库为sqlserver2008,使用c#语言 ...
- asp.net毕业生信息管理系统VS开发sqlserver数据库web结构c#编程计算机网页源码项目
一.源码特点 asp.net 毕业生信息管理系统 是一套完善的web设计管理系统,系统具有完整的源代码和数据库,系统主要采用B/S模式开发.开发环境为vs2010,数据库为sqlse ...
- asp.net学生信息管理系统VS开发sqlserver数据库web结构c#编程计算机网页源码项目
一.源码特点 ASP.NET C# 学生信息管理系统是一套完善的web设计管理系统,系统具有完整的源代码和数据库,系统主要采用B/S模式开发,开发环境为vs2010,数据库为sqlse ...
- C++ 纯WIN32 API编程 悦读器实战示例
/* 最后修改:2020-09-21 14:04 <C++编程示例大全> 作者:张国鹏 本例功能:C++ 纯WIN32 API编程 悦读器实战示例 软件下载:http://lovegp.c ...
- 编程不仅是写代码!?
作者 | keypressingmonkey 译者 | 孙薇,责编 | 夕颜 出品 | CSDN(ID:CSDNnews) 1. 非天才生存指南 承认这一点很难,我的正式简历上也不会有:我是一名普通的 ...
- 自学前端简历怎么写?项目怎么学?
本篇含简历模板+项目学习+项目经验分享,送全套前端路. 一.简历模板 这里就不多说了,是什么写什么就好. 开发经验 ⚫ 精通 HTML.CSS.JS 基础,熟悉 H5.CSS3 新属性,熟悉 ES6 ...
最新文章
- Nature:拟南芥微生物组功能研究
- 企业级 CICD 工具部署 Serverless 应用的落地实践
- 临床、实验室和流行病学研究的样本量 Sample Sizes for Clinical, Laboratory and Epidemiology Studies
- 【Python】字符串对齐的常用方法
- tp5 修改配置参数 view_replace_str 无效
- 口无遮拦的钉钉与坐立不安的腾讯
- springboot 事务统一配置_Spring Boot实现分布式微服务开发实战系列(五)
- 深度 | Google Brain研究工程师:为什么随机性对于深度学习如此重要?
- TensorFlow精进之路(十六):使用slim模型库对图片分类
- Windows10 中在指定目录下启动Powershell
- 三维激光扫描数据处理理论及应用
- 苹果和FBI出庭日期延后
- ria技术_JavaFXpert RIA示例挑战截止日期已延长
- 动易CMS 复制word里面带图文的文章,图片可以直接显示
- 计算机网络课程论文:《浅谈交换机、路由器》
- 采用最终一致性解决微服务一致性问题
- 使用keytool转换签名证书格式,keyStore、jks签名证书相互转换
- 计算机二级c语言考试上机内容,计算机二级c语言上机考试操作步骤及流程
- 微擎url模式解读_微擎常用开发文档
- js 前端常用时间操作:时间戳、当前时间
热门文章
- SPI的NSS硬件模式
- 7628刷breed_自制各类路由原厂直刷Breed的文件,无需修改mac无需重刷无线
- 数学分析:集合的基本运算
- CTF 竞赛入门指南(CTF All In One)学习(七)
- 有赞Java面试经验_有赞面试记录二
- arm-linux-gcc电子相册,基于TQ2440的电子相册项目实现
- 日语五十音图的记忆方法
- 【75】颜色分类--荷兰国旗问题
- 华中科技大学计算机上机,华中科技大学_2010___考研计算机_复试上机
- _putw、putc、puts和putchar应用差别